Space gray black out?

I have a 2007 335i space gray coupe and I'm thinking of blacking out the kidney grills lower mesh grills window trim and emblem also a black and space gray roundels do you think this will look good on space gray and stock 5 spoke wheels or should I just black out the front kidneys and lower mesh

If you are going to black it all out, then that should look good since it's a nice balance over the whole car. If you just do the grilles and lower mesh, black out the just inner pieces of the grilles, and keep the chrome rings. That keeps a nice balance with the window trim. You can either paint them, or just get a matte black grille set and swap out the inside pieces. They snap in and out so you can go back, or all black if you want to.
